Week 12 and I'm getting better at not fussing over how little I get done during the week. As most of you have seen I posted another video of my game, and I'm just super happy I got that one thing done. I was worried on the programming aspect. I now feel much more confidant in getting the rest done and other things that need to be programmed in. I'm still on the fence if I want you to actually equip the item to use it, which means lots of default menu switching, or do I want to hunker down and design my own menu for using the Tools.
I was actually having FUN getting that to work and designing that little dungeon. Putting the pieces in, getting a puzzle or two in, crafting Roman's dialogue, this is the excitement I get when making a game. Now I'm stuck on what to work on next. Mapping areas is boring, actually drawing/editing characters and monsters pixel by pixel is boring. Programming events and drawing concepts is fun to me, designing animations and seeing them in combat is fun. I want to complete this game, so I'm forcing myself to get through the stuff I find boring so I have all the exciting fun stuff at the end to do.
I also want to get a demo out for people so everyone can see my little world...and criticize the hell out of it, because I know not everything will be perfect :3
